About Clearwater Community Gardens: The Community Garden was founded in 2014 with the purpose of building community in the Gateway area of downtown Clearwater. The Mission is to improve the Downtown Gateway community by creating a safe environment where inter-ethnic and inter-generational activities can flourish through education and production of fresh food focused around a community garden. https://www.facebook.com/ClearwaterCommunityGardens, or www.clearwatercommunitygardens.org.
